HEAR - Trinity Access Programmes - Trinity College Dublin

WebWhat is HEAR? The Higher Education Access Route is an admissions route for school leavers who for social, financial or cultural reasons are under-represented in third level education. It was set up to ensure that all Leaving Certificate students have a fair and equal opportunity to progress to third level education. WebThe Disability Access Route to Education (DARE) is a college and university admissions scheme which offers places on a reduced points basis to school leavers with disabilities. WebAn example of a reduced points offer is where the Leaving Certificate points for a particular course is 366 points, and an eligible HEAR applicant could be offered a place with a lower points score, e.g. 356 points. Webreduced points places for eligible HEAR and DARE applicants who do not achieve the CAO points for their chosen programme. In order to compete for one of these places, applicants must meet all the admissions criteria, achieve a minimum of 300 CAO points and come within a differential of 40 points below the CAO cut-off.
